I came home from shopping, one day
I was really worn out
As soon as I pulled into the driveway
I heard my husband shout

He sounded like he was dying
Running, as fast as I could
I was shaking and crying
There against the wall, he stood

I thought, "OH NO, A HEART ATTACK!!"
He seemed to be holding on, for support
Gotta call the ambulance.....
An emergency, to report!

"Here Sweetheart, let me help you lie down
The ambulance is on the way...."
And in a weak feeble voice, he looked up at me.....
I leaned down to hear what he had to say....

Holding him close
And trying to console
"Honey," he begins......
"Thank you, for being so concerned ......
I can't find the remote control!!"
